Job Description


Job responsibilities

  • Control cost calculation and update process
    • Share quotation upload rule with each BU to make sure it is clear for everyone
    • Calculate Asia platform target PRIE according to group mark up and margin co-efficient, compare the latest quotation with the target PRIE to find the classification which need to be improved and analyzed deeply
    • Compare the quotations based on previous season and budget
    • Check over abnormal costs evolution in upstream process
    • Update the system PRIA after it is finalized in quotation system
    • Analyze sourcing variation per season once purchase price is finalized
    • Check the total actual seasonal margin whether in line with the forecast
    • Review overhead rate per season and per year to make sure it include the correct related cost
  • Flow up internal procedure about price validation
    • Cross check the final purchase price with the final uploaded quotation according to the nominated timeline
    • Familiar with the current used system, and give value added comments when there is a system upgrade or changes
  • Update standard cost information in FCST, MTP and Budget
    • According to requested time schedule, update standard cost according to latest information
    • Work closely with group controlling to smooth the new cube or function used in Hyperion to improve the efficiency of forecasting
  • Play an active role in the monthly closing process
    • Check monthly margin situation, compared to the seasonal margin to explain the differences
    • Be back up for the business analyst to do the monthly closing
    • Be familiar with all financial and internal control working processes to increase the business sense

Company Info

For LACOSTE, Life is a Beautiful Sport! 

Since the very first polo was created in 1933, LACOSTE relies on its authentic sportive roots to spring optimism and elegance on the world thanks to a unique and original lifestyle for women, men and children. 

With a vision to be the leading player in the premium casual wear market, the Crocodile brand is today present in 120 countries through a selective distribution network. Two LACOSTE items are sold every second in the world. 

As an international group gathering 10,000 women and men, LACOSTE offers a complete range of products: apparel, leather goods, fragrances, footwear, eyewear, home wear, watches and underwear, all of them being  elaborated  in  the most qualitative, responsible and ethical way.  In 2016, the brand garnered a turnover of more than 2 billion euros.
